    Paleoecology is the study of fossils and their interaction with each other and their environments. It focuses on understanding ancient ecosystems, including the relationships between organisms, their habitats, and the environmental conditions in which they lived. By examining fossils, paleoecologists can reconstruct past ecosystems and gain insights into how they functioned and changed over time. This field of study helps us understand the dynamics of ancient life on Earth and provides valuable information for understanding and predicting ecological changes in the future.

    Palynology is the study of pollens and spores. It involves the examination and analysis of these microscopic structures found in plants, fungi, and some protists. Palynologists use various techniques to study and identify pollens and spores, such as microscopy, chemical analysis, and DNA sequencing. This field of study is important for understanding plant evolution, ecology, and biodiversity, as well as for applications in forensic science, archaeology, and paleoclimatology.

    Micropaleontology is the correct answer because it refers to the study of microscopic fossil organisms. This field of science focuses on the examination and analysis of microfossils, which include tiny organisms such as foraminifera, diatoms, and pollen grains. By studying these microscopic fossils, scientists can gain insights into past environments, climate change, and the evolution of different species. Micropaleontology plays a crucial role in understanding Earth's history and can provide valuable information about the geological past.

Evo Devo is an abbreviation for Evolutionary Development, which is a field of biology that studies how changes in the development of organisms contribute to evolutionary changes. It combines principles from both evolutionary biology and developmental biology to understand the genetic and molecular mechanisms underlying the development of organisms and how these mechanisms have evolved over time.
